ASHBURN, VA– Cleaning tests were recently conducted by Kester and Zestron during a combined technical training workshop at Zestron’s Application Technology Center in Ashburn.

Excellent cleaning results were reportedly achieved as Zestron’s cleaning agents were able to fully remove solder paste and flux residues from Kester’s lead-free and eutectic products. The two parties then worked to optimize application parameters for the tested products.

Application recommendations based on the testing are now available through Kester.

 

New York -- Dover Electronics has acquired Colder Products Co. (St. Paul, MN). Colder will join the Components Group of companies within Dover Electronics, a subsidiary of Dover Corp.
 
Colder a designer and manufacturer of plastic quick disconnect couplings and specialized liquid and gas handling devices for low pressure plastic tubing connections. Colder sells its products in the life sciences/medical, specialty industrial and chemical/food dispensing markets. The company expects to generate sales of nearly $50 million in 2005.

TORONTO -- Celestica Inc. has acquired CoreSim, a Canadian-based provider of advanced design analysis and redesign services. CoreSim will strengthen Celestica's design services by adding intellectual property, including its engineering tools and processes for electronic design projects. CoreSim currently provides services to some of the world's leading OEMs.

CoreSim will offer its proprietary tool, Schematic Modeling, that identifies wiring and technology issues in schematics. It provides design analysis which independently verifies and validates pre-layout customer designs to assist in keeping engineering projects on-time and within budget.
